int pinLed8 = 2;
int pinLed7 = 3;
int pinLed6 = 4;
int pinLed5 = 5;
int pinLed4 = 6;
int pinLed3 = 7;
int pinLed2 = 8;
int pinLed1 = 9;
int pinPot = A0;
void setup()
{
pinMode(pinLed1, OUTPUT);
pinMode(pinLed2, OUTPUT);
pinMode(pinLed3, OUTPUT);
pinMode(pinLed4, OUTPUT);
pinMode(pinLed5, OUTPUT);
pinMode(pinLed6, OUTPUT);
pinMode(pinLed7, OUTPUT);
pinMode(pinLed8, OUTPUT);
}
void loop()
{
int nilaiPot = analogRead(pinPot);
if (nilaiPot > 0)
{
digitalWrite(pinLed1, HIGH);
}
else
{
digitalWrite(pinLed1, LOW);
}
if (nilaiPot > 200)
{
digitalWrite(pinLed2, HIGH);
} else
{
digitalWrite(pinLed2, LOW);
}
if (nilaiPot > 300)
{
digitalWrite(pinLed3, HIGH);
}
else
{
digitalWrite(pinLed3, LOW);
}
if (nilaiPot > 400)
{
digitalWrite(pinLed4, HIGH);
}
else
{
digitalWrite(pinLed4, LOW);
}
if (nilaiPot > 500)
{
digitalWrite(pinLed5, HIGH);
}
else
{
digitalWrite(pinLed5, LOW);
}
if (nilaiPot > 600)
{
digitalWrite(pinLed6, HIGH);
}
else
{
digitalWrite(pinLed6, LOW);
}
if (nilaiPot > 800)
{
digitalWrite(pinLed7, HIGH);
}
else
{
digitalWrite(pinLed7, LOW);
}
if (nilaiPot > 1000)
{
digitalWrite(pinLed8, HIGH);
}
else
{
digitalWrite(pinLed8, LOW);
}
}
